Video Transcript

The end of the world is coming before midnight tonight!  This was the alarming prediction of a would-be prophet in the late 1950's.  After playing a basketball game away from our high school, the talk among us players was sober, not only for losing the game, but because we all wondered if that prediction might be true.  When we left the bus and headed home many of us said to each other, if that prophet is right, it's been nice knowing you.  I tossed and turned in bed that evening wondering if that prophet could be right.

When morning came, and I was alive to see it, I knew another wild prediction had not come to pass.  There have been many individuals who have claimed that they knew when the return of Christ would be and the end of this world.  One very famous prediction was of an Adventist preacher named William Miller who calculated the return of Jesus Christ to be October 22, 1844.  After giving away or selling property and lands, he and thousands of his followers gathered together to await this awesome, anticipated event.  After midnight came and no return of Christ, there was a great disappointment when the calculations proved to be false.  William Miller, to his credit, had the courage to admit he was wrong and died in obscurity five years later.

You may hear of individuals in our day who claim they "know" when Christ is going to return and the world is going to end.  While Jesus gave His disciples certain signs to watch for that indicated His return, he stated in no uncertain terms that no one knows the exact date except His Father. 

In Mark 13:32 we read, "But of that day and hour no one knows, not even the angels in heaven, nor the Son, but only the Father."

Matthew's account puts it this way, "Watch therefore, for you know neither the day nor the hour in which the Son of Man is coming" (Matthew 25:13)

Don't be shaken by alarmists who claim they know the exact time of Christ's return and the "end of the world" but do watch the warning signs that Jesus Christ gave in Matthew 24.  When you see those signs being fulfilled, know that the return of Christ is near.

By the way, now, fifty years later from my high school days, we know we are nearer to Christ's return than we were in 1950!  So, watch!

For GN Magazine, I'm Gary Antion.
